Pull label of air cleaner, left glue
I pulled the warning label off the air clean and a lot of glue was left behind. What is the best/easiest way to remove the glue with out marring the chrome?

Try some WD-40 on a rag, that should take it off

Got mine cleaned off in about 30 seconds with a little shot of Ronsonol (ya know.. lighter fluid). No obvious traces or negative affects.

I used rubbing alcohol (90% isopropyl, from walmart) and a soft cloth and the adhesive came off without attacking the plastic.
